‎M/Z. Khan, Mohd Yusuf, Archana Kaushik‎

‎Elderly Women: Vulnerability and Support Structures [Hardcover]‎

‎Of late, the situation of elderly women has globally attracted the attention of the civil society. Not only do they tend to outnumber their male counterparts, but also their morbidity pattern economic dependence and social situation entitle them to a concerted policy and programme attention. The situation of elderly women in India is no different. And added to this is the issue of vulnerability. This calls for an objective analysis of their situation which would, in turn, pave the way of effective intervention strategies.This in view, this book focuses on a cross-section of elderly women in nine states of India having a high proportion of BPL hourseholds, including Assam, Bihar, Chhattisgarh, Jharkhand, Madhya Pradesh, Odisha, Sikkim and Uttar Pradesh. Going deep into their socio-demographic background, it addresses issues pertaining to their livelihood, nutrition and health, interpersonal relations and vulnerability risks. It also presents a critical assessment of the awareness and availability of existing social security schemes meant to shield the elderly women from undeserved want and vulnerability. The book will be of interest to NGOs, social activists and researchers, as well as to policy-makers, social planners and social welfare functionaries. ‎Ma-Fa [Marie Fantova]‎

‎Krízovka Sveta: Fotomontáz z Cestování‎

‎Prague: Fr. Borový 1938. Hardcover. Near Fine -/very good -. Hofmeister Adolf. 188 4 p.: illustrations by Adolf Hofmeister; 21 cm. Orange cloth with black spine and cover titles; brown black and orange decoration of front cover to resemble a suitcase. Dust jacket with front section echoing front cover suitcase illustration. Publisher's advertisement for travel works by Karla Capka on back dust jacket section. The third volume in the series Knihy Dobré Pohody. Ma-Fa was the pseudonym of the Czech journalist and author Marie Fantová 1893-1963. Book is in Near Fine- Condition: boards are slightly curved; clean and tight. ‎MacKinstry Elizabeth‎

‎Puck in Pasture: Verse & Decorations by Elizabeth MacKinstry‎

‎Garden City: Doubleday Page & Co 1925. Hardcover. Very Good . Stated First Edition. viii 2 79 3 p.: illustrations; 22 cm. Black cloth spine with printed paper spine label; color decorated paper over boards with printed paper label on front board. Illustrated endpapers. No dust jacket. The author and illustrator Elizabeth MacKinstry 1878-1956 was born in Pennsylvania but grew up in Paris where she studied the violin with Eugene Ysaye. After her musical career ended by illness she studied art. This was her first published work which began her long career as an illustrator.
